Abstract

Eddy current field excited by a parallel coil placed next to a ferromagnetic pipe with remanence is studied in this paper. The influence of the remanence is analyzed at first. The analytical solutions to the ferromagnetic pipe eddy current field are deduced by means of a second-order vector potential formalism, and the analytical expression for the impedance change of the excitation coil is constructed. Theoretical analysis of the influence for the remanence and the analytical solutions to the eddy current field are verified by experiments.
